What Are Faceless YouTube Channels?

Faceless YouTube channels are where creators don’t show their faces on camera. This trend uses voiceovers, animations, and more to tell stories. It lets creators stay private while still connecting with viewers.

These channels offer a wide range of content. You can find tutorials, commentary, and stories without seeing the creator. This way, the focus is on the content, not the person making it.

Faceless channels change how we watch and interact with videos. They make content quality more important than who’s making it. This opens up a world of creativity and imagination for viewers.

Faceless YouTube Channels and Monetization

Faceless YouTube channels offer unique chances for creators to make money. They can explore different ways to earn without showing their faces. This is key for anyone wanting to start a channel.

Different Revenue Streams Available

There are many ways for faceless channels to make money. Here are some main ones:

  • Advertising Revenue: Creators can use Google AdSense to earn from ads on their videos.
  • Sponsorships: Brands partner with channels that match their audience, offering good money.
  • Merchandise Sales: Selling branded items can add to income and promote the channel.
  • Memberships: Fans can support creators on Patreon for exclusive content and perks.
  • Affiliate Marketing: Creators can earn commissions by promoting products with referral links.
